Transaction 3565faa6da6077895a27363c03a2254e1e2b2a6ffd9bf561aac2a701fe6a1b24
1 Input
1 Output
-
3565faa6da6077895a27363c03a2254e1e2b2a6ffd9bf561aac2a701fe6a1b24:0
- value
- 2254055
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 19c37b77f7735abfde1a5c5694df54d8dca4cb85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ME59MWzmUvhLGzcva1JRtQ38yoR9tpBA